  14. The Bang O Lure was the first balsa wood bait made by the late Jim Bagley. Improved and perfected over the years this bait offers tremendous performance to serious anglers. Fish it on the surface like a jerk bait then on the retrieve it has a very wide wobble that big fish love. The body is wider than other balsa minnow style baits making this lure very easy to cast.
